Caregivers Count In Michigan It is estimated that nationally one in four households are involved in caregiving for a loved one aged 50 or older. In Michigan this represents over 786,446 households. | • Caring Sheets: Thoughts & Suggestions for Caring The Dementia Care Series worksheets at Lansing Community College are edited and produced by EMU Huron Woods Alzheimer's Research Program for the Michigan Department of Community Health. | • The League of Experienced Family Caregivers The League of Experienced Family Caregivers is a registry of family members who care for their spouses, parents, or other elderly relatives and who want to help other families by sharing information about their experiences as caregivers. | • Respite Care Consumer Fact Sheet Caregivers want to provide quality care for their loved ones, and the best way to do this is to take care of oneself.
